Winter Parking Ban Just Around the Corner

Woburn's parking ban goes into effect on Tuesday, November 15.

No one knows when snow will start to fall in Woburn, because after all, it is New England. 

But that is known is where residents can and can't park in the city starting in the middle of this month.

The Woburn Police Department is reminding residents that the winter parking ban goes into effect at 2 a.m. on Friday, Nov. 15.

Through the city ordinance, street parking is allowed on the odd side of the street only between 2 a.m. and 6 a.m. Any vehicles that are parked on the even side of the street during those hours may be given a $20 fine. Parking restrictions last from November 15 to March 31.

In addition, city officials can declare a complete ban on street parking during a snow emergency. In that case, any vehicles parked on the street during a snow emergency may be towed at the owner's expense.

"Patrol officers have been ordered to ticket all cars in violation of the ordinance and to report all repeat offenders to the traffic bureau," police said in a parking ban announcement.
